7 London Way, Kingston is a 5 bedroom, 3 bathroom House with 6 parking spaces. The property has a land size of 847m2 and floor size of 318m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in November 2025. There are other 5 bedroom House sold in Kingston in the last 12 months.

The size of Kingston is approximately 37.3 square kilometres. There are 29 parks, covering nearly 8.9% of the total area. The population of Kingston in 2016 was 10409 people. By 2021 the population was 12288 showing a population growth of 18.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Kingston is 30-39 years. Households in Kingston are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Kingston work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 67.90% of the homes in Kingston were owner-occupied compared with 67.30% in 2016.
